Transaction 758e1cf5ea4fc30e04a8fada44d394bfbf6772e3d69094ec570c33ea498c8d86

2 Input
2 Outputs
  • 758e1cf5ea4fc30e04a8fada44d394bfbf6772e3d69094ec570c33ea498c8d86:0
  • value  139000
    address  34q7BmWum5zgvwiKTTniDcF7x2jnPWxHiR
  • 758e1cf5ea4fc30e04a8fada44d394bfbf6772e3d69094ec570c33ea498c8d86:1
  • value  1014586
    address  3LM5NnCU345bPuNZW5CArDtFdkwtTgG44H